Impatient in reply to endo_star

Yes far too ambitious. You just need one kid accidentally running in to your belly and whoosh ARGHHHHHHH! A Lap op takes absolute minimum 2 weeks of rest before attempting to do activities like school or even driving a car. Thats for the most basic 'look around inside' only op.

You will have been stabbed in the somach at least 3 times possibly up to 5 times, never mind everything they might do inside you.

Then post op you're still filled with gas from the op they use to pump up your stomach cavity, and that needs shifting, by farting and burbing it out. don't be shy, it hurts like blazes till you get it out of your system by whatever method you can. everyone on the gynae war that's had surgery will be doing the same thing. Also helps recovery to get out of bed the next day and take short walks up and down the war every waking hour if possible. Especially while you are still pumped with gas and on morphine after the op. Once they switch off your morphine and put you on less powerful painrelief that's really when the gas pains are noticeable. Moving around will disperse that gas and help it out of you much quicker than just lying in bed.

If they find endo and work on you with lasers or excision surgery inside, then expect to be off for even longer perhaps 6 or even 8 weeks. It depends on what they do inside you.

You might find it easier to return to work on reduced hours, just afternoons for example. Recovery after an op can leave you feeling super tired as your body is stuggling to heal several wound sites at the same time. Pushing yourself to do too much too soon, will set you back and just delay any recovery time even more. Look after yourself first, then you'll be recovered quicker and better able to cope with the joys of rampaging kids and reaching up on walls with a staple gun and all the other stretching and reaching at school that will put a strain on your tummy.

15th is definitely far too soon. I'd aim for May bank holiday as a more realistic target.

Hi, I had lap on the Saturday and was back at work the following Saturday. I was exhausted after and would have loved another week off but been back to work. As I'm self employed I've probably only been working half the amount and had to keep dosed up on painkillers to get through. If you can sit and teach and rest lots in the evening you should be fine. I have had pains in my legs which I think maybe from irratated nerves which causes pains but hasn't stopped me working. If its a diagnostic you should feel better after 4 days and be up but you won't want to go anywhere for at least 5-6 days. Everyone is different but just enjoy the rest and move around when you feel up to it. The quicker you walk just around house the wind gets moving and helps you feel better too x good luck you'll be fine and if you don't remember what doctor tells you ask nurse if she can go over notes. I did and she was really helpful in explaining what they found. Good luck have a nice sleep you'll be fine xx
